Is the Larger Business Loan a secured loan?
Asset security is necessary for accessing funds over $150,000. This is as a result of an charge on assets, and may include registration with the PPSR or the registration of a caveat.
A director’s or personal guarantee is a guarantee to repay credit that is general in nature rather than defining security over an asset. The person who signs the ensure is personally liable in the event that the business lender is not able to pay back the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online register operated by the New Zealand Government. It reflects security interests that are registered for personal property (including the assets or goods). The PPSR grants prioritisation over property that is personal to be assigned in accordance with the date on which a security interest has been registered.
The caveat can be described as a formal document lodged to provide notice of a legal claim against a property.

About business loans
What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
An asset-based loan is when the business owner borrows from an asset that they own to get the funds for a loan. The asset could be an asset belonging to the personal, like the family home, or it could be a business asset such as a vehicle or piece or equipment.
The vast majority of banks, including the big banks, tend to make loans secured by assets. If you are having difficulty paying back the loan, then the asset could be taken over by the lender. In essence, it’s the process of securing new financing using the worth of the asset you already have.
